The local chapter of the American Red Cross has expressed concern because blood donations are down. It has received a report fro

m the national American Red Cross, which shows why people are reluctant to donate blood. This report is an example of _____ data.
Social Studies
1 answer:
jenyasd209 [6]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

Secondary data

Explanation:

Secondary data is the data collected by the researcher for investigation previously. This data can be assessed by the researcher. The secondary data is opposite or contrast to the primary data. Primary data is like the data collected directly.

The secondary is the data which increases the sampling data. It is the source of a large research project. The big source of secondary data is government libraries, internet, departments. Social media is the largest source of research. It is is the interest source for investigators.

April Jackson's students have difficulty understanding the concept pressure, tending to equate it with force. To try to help her
madreJ [45]

Answer:

d. demonstration.

Explanation:

According to a different source, these are the options that come with this question:

a. simulation.

b. model.

c. case study.

d. demonstration.

This is an example of a demonstration. A demonstration is an example in which the person exemplifies how something is performed. This is usually a practical exhibition, and it allows the person to give proof or evidence of how something operates. In this example, April is able to show the difference between pressure and force through her demonstration.
